Ink -jet printers

Image
Ink -jet Printers : They produce images by spraying tiny droplets of ink onto the paper. They have very high quality output and can also produce coloured graphics. These printers are less noisy. The common speed of inkiet printers ' is 300 dpi (dots per inch).

Laser printers

Image
Laser printers : These printers use photocopy technology to print. They have very high speed and are quieter in operation. They produce very high image quality. They are mostly used for DTP purpose. They can handle about 6 to 10 pages of printed material per minute.

Dot Matrix Printer

Image
Dot-Matrix Printers : They are the only impact printers in use nowadays. As they are noisy and do not have good printing quality. they are losing Popularity. Besides text, they are capable of printing charts and graphics. They are relatively economical .These printers have print head with pins on it which print dots on the paper to form characters. The speed oi dot matrix ranges from 50 cps to 400 cps.

What is scanner

Image
SCANNER lt is an input device that optically scans text, images and objects. The scanned data is then converted into a digital image and is displayed on the computer monitor. The . most popular scanner is the desktop scanner, also called the Flatbed scanner, which has a glass window where the document/object is placed for scanning. Another popular category of scanner is the hand held scanner used in libraries, shopping malls etc.

What is ROM

Image
ROM ROM stands for Read Only Memory. It is called so, as the user can only read from it and cannot write into it. It is a non-volatile memory as it stores information permanently and cannot be changed. The primary use of ROM is during the booting, which is the initial program to start up the computer, when power is switched on. Example: An audio-video disk resembles ROM, as the songs once stored on it cannot be changed.

What is Ram

RAM RAM (Random Access Memory) is an important components of memory unit. Whatever information we enter into the computer goes into RAM and remains there as long as we are working in an application: it is a volatile memory as data and instructions are stored temporarily, during its processing and lost forever, when the computer is switched off.

What is mother board

Image
MOTHERBOARD The motherboard is an electronic board found at the bottom of the desktop case or at the side of a tower case. it is the largest circuit board. it has expansion slots for connecting additional circuit boards. A Motherboard has a processor chip, memory chips, and many other logic circuits. It is also called System board and is the most important hardware component of a computer.

Computer input and output devices

INPUT & OUTPUT DEVICES Key Board   A keyboard is a most common input device. A computer keyboard looks very much like an ordinary Typewriter keyboard, which is familiar to all of us. A computer keyboard in addition to the letter and number keys of ordinary typewriters has some special keys for special functions. A computer’s CPU can understand only electrical signals (coded pulses). When we press any key on the keyboard, the key sends a series of electrical pulses to the computer. The pattern of these pulses presents a code for that particular character. The computer receives it, interprets it and it‘ is stored in the memory. Printers Types of Printers. Printers can be divided into two major categories; Impact Printers and Non-impact Printers. Impact printers are those printers in which printing of a character is achieved by striking of hammers or pins through a ribbon to deposit carbon or ink onto the paper.
